In her new book, \u003cem\u003eFarming in the Black Patch\u003c\/em\u003e, Kentucky author Bobbie Smith Bryant captures the culture of the region and the intricacies of tobacco production. She details the arduous work of running a modern tobacco farm, but also records much of the region’s history, including the Black Patch War of the early twentieth century.\u003c\/span\u003e\u003c\/span\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"gmail_default\"\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eThis beautiful, nine-by-ten-inch book includes 192 pages and hundreds of full-color photos.
